Titus Chapter 2 Young's Literal Translation

Titus 2:1

And thou -- be speaking what doth become the sound teaching;

Titus 2:2

aged men to be temperate, grave, sober, sound in the faith, in the love, in the endurance;

Titus 2:3

aged women, in like manner, in deportment as doth become sacred persons, not false accusers, to much wine not enslaved, of good things teachers,

Titus 2:4

that they may make the young women sober-minded, to be lovers of `their' husbands, lovers of `their' children,

Titus 2:5

sober, pure, keepers of `their own' houses, good, subject to their own husbands, that the word of God may not be evil spoken of.

Titus 2:6

The younger men, in like manner, be exhorting to be sober-minded;

Titus 2:7

concerning all things thyself showing a pattern of good works; in the teaching uncorruptedness, gravity, incorruptibility,

Titus 2:8

discourse sound, irreprehensible, that he who is of the contrary part may be ashamed, having nothing evil to say concerning you.

Titus 2:9

Servants -- to their own masters `are' to be subject, in all things to be well-pleasing, not gainsaying,

Titus 2:10

not purloining, but showing all good stedfastness, that the teaching of God our Saviour they may adorn in all things.

Titus 2:11

For the saving grace of God was manifested to all men,

Titus 2:12

teaching us, that denying the impiety and the worldly desires, soberly and righteously and piously we may live in the present age,

Titus 2:13

waiting for the blessed hope and manifestation of the glory of our great God and Saviour Jesus Christ,

Titus 2:14

who did give himself for us, that he might ransom us from all lawlessness, and might purify to himself a peculiar people, zealous of good works;

Titus 2:15

these things be speaking, and exhorting, and convicting, with all charge; let no one despise thee!
